通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

有趣的软件研发有哪些

有趣的软件研发有哪些

有趣的软件研发有哪些?

在当前的科技时代,软件研发无疑成为了一个热门的领域。有趣的软件研发主要有:游戏开发、人工智能软件开发、虚拟现实软件开发、移动应用开发和开源软件开发。其中,游戏开发因其创新性和娱乐性而备受关注。

一、游戏开发

游戏开发是一个充满创意和挑战的领域。它不仅需要开发者有扎实的编程技能,还需要他们有丰富的艺术和设计感知。现代游戏开发已经不再局限于单一的平台或者类型,而是涵盖了各种类型的游戏,包括角色扮演游戏、策略游戏、冒险游戏等。同时,游戏开发也可以在不同的平台上进行,如PC、游戏机、移动设备等。

在游戏开发过程中,开发者需要考虑到游戏的玩家体验,这包括游戏的剧情、角色、操作方式、视觉效果等各个方面。此外,游戏开发者还需要对游戏市场有深入的了解,以便制作出能够吸引玩家的游戏。因此,游戏开发是一个需要多方面技能和知识的领域。

二、人工智能软件开发

人工智能(AI)已经成为软件研发中最有趣和最具挑战性的领域之一。人工智能的目标是创建能够理解、学习、适应和模拟人类行为的机器。在这个领域中,开发者可以研究和开发各种AI技术,包括机器学习、深度学习、自然语言处理、计算机视觉等。

AI软件开发的应用非常广泛,包括自动驾驶、语音识别、图像识别、推荐系统等。这些应用不仅能够改变我们的生活,也为软件开发者提供了无尽的创新可能。因此,AI软件开发是一个既有趣又具有深远影响的领域。

三、虚拟现实软件开发

虚拟现实(VR)是一种模拟环境的技术,它可以让用户通过交互式的3D图像和声音,感受到一种仿佛置身于虚拟环境中的体验。VR软件开发涉及到图形渲染、物理模拟、交互设计等多个领域的知识。

VR软件开发的应用非常广泛,包括游戏、教育、娱乐、医疗等。例如,医生可以通过VR软件进行手术模拟,教师可以通过VR软件进行虚拟教学,游戏开发者可以通过VR软件开发出沉浸式的游戏。因此,VR软件开发是一个有趣且具有广泛应用的领域。

四、移动应用开发

移动应用开发是软件开发的一个重要部分。随着智能手机和移动设备的普及,移动应用开发已经成为了一个不可忽视的领域。在这个领域中,开发者可以开发出各种各样的应用,包括社交应用、娱乐应用、商业应用等。

移动应用开发的挑战在于,开发者需要考虑到不同的设备和操作系统,以及他们的特性和限制。此外,移动应用开发还需要考虑到用户的移动使用习惯和需求。因此,移动应用开发是一个需要深入理解用户和技术的领域。

五、开源软件开发

开源软件开发是指软件的源代码被公开,任何人都可以查看、学习和修改。开源软件开发的优势在于,开发者可以借鉴和学习其他人的代码,同时也可以向整个社区贡献自己的代码。

开源软件开发的应用非常广泛,包括操作系统、数据库、编程语言、开发工具等。在这个领域中,开发者可以通过参与开源项目,提高自己的编程技能和项目管理能力。因此,开源软件开发是一个有趣且具有深远影响的领域。

总结起来,有趣的软件研发领域有许多,它们各有特色,提供了无尽的创新可能性和挑战。无论你是对游戏开发、AI软件开发、VR软件开发、移动应用开发还是开源软件开发感兴趣,你都可以在这些领域中找到你的位置,并发挥你的专业技能和创新精神。

相关问答FAQs:

什么是有趣的软件研发?

有趣的软件研发是指开发人员使用创新的思维和技术,设计和构建充满乐趣和创意的软件应用程序。

有哪些有趣的软件研发项目可以尝试?

    1. 游戏开发:开发各种类型的游戏,如益智游戏、角色扮演游戏等,让用户在玩游戏的同时获得乐趣和娱乐。
    1. 虚拟现实应用:开发虚拟现实应用程序,让用户可以沉浸在虚拟的世界中,体验不同的场景和体验。
    1. 创意工具应用:开发创意工具应用,如绘画应用、音乐制作应用等,让用户可以发挥自己的创造力和想象力。

有趣的软件研发有什么好处?

    1. 吸引用户:有趣的软件研发可以吸引更多的用户使用,增加用户粘性和用户留存率。
    1. 提升品牌形象:有趣的软件研发可以提升品牌形象,让用户对品牌产生好感和认同感。
    1. 增加盈利机会:有趣的软件研发可以增加盈利机会,如通过广告、付费功能等获得收益。
相关文章